@metarebalance/dadata-mcp
Provides tools to retrieve city IDs in the DPD delivery service via the DaData API.
Click on "Install Server".
Wait a few minutes for the server to deploy. Once ready, it will show a "Started" state.
In the chat, type
@followed by the MCP server name and your instructions, e.g., "@@metarebalance/dadata-mcpsuggest address for Москва"
That's it! The server will respond to your query, and you can continue using it as needed.
Here is a step-by-step guide with screenshots.
@metarebalance/dadata-mcp
31 инструмент вместо ~4 у официального DaData MCP. Полное покрытие DaData API — адреса, компании, банки, телефоны, email, паспорта, автомобили, геокодирование и 12 справочников. Локальная установка через
npx, без внешнего хостинга. Часть серии Russian API MCP (47 серверов) by @theYahia.
Почему этот, а не официальный MCP от DaData?
У DaData есть официальный MCP-сервер с 4 инструментами. Наш пакет покрывает весь API:
Официальный MCP | @metarebalance/dadata-mcp | |
Инструменты | 4 | 31 |
Ресурсы | 0 | 2 |
Промпты | 0 | 2 |
Транспорт | Удалённый | Локальный stdio |
Бесплатные | 1 | 23 |
npm-пакет | Нет | Да |
Related MCP server: amoCRM MCP Server
Быстрый старт
Claude Desktop
Добавьте в claude_desktop_config.json:
{
"mcpServers": {
"dadata": {
"command": "npx",
"args": ["-y", "@metarebalance/dadata-mcp"],
"env": {
"DADATA_API_KEY": "ваш-api-ключ",
"DADATA_SECRET_KEY": "ваш-секретный-ключ"
}
}
}
}Claude Code
claude mcp add dadata -- npx -y @metarebalance/dadata-mcpVS Code / Cursor
Добавьте в .vscode/mcp.json:
{
"servers": {
"dadata": {
"command": "npx",
"args": ["-y", "@metarebalance/dadata-mcp"],
"env": {
"DADATA_API_KEY": "ваш-api-ключ",
"DADATA_SECRET_KEY": "ваш-секретный-ключ"
}
}
}
}Windsurf
Добавьте в настройки MCP Toolkit:
{
"mcpServers": {
"dadata": {
"command": "npx",
"args": ["-y", "@metarebalance/dadata-mcp"],
"env": {
"DADATA_API_KEY": "ваш-api-ключ",
"DADATA_SECRET_KEY": "ваш-секретный-ключ"
}
}
}
}Инструменты (31)
Адреса (3)
Инструмент | Стоимость | Описание |
| Бесплатно | Автодополнение адресов с индексом, ФИАС, координатами, часовым поясом |
| 0.20 ₽ | Стандартизация адреса в 80+ полей с кодами качества |
| Бесплатно | Адрес по коду ФИАС, КЛАДР или кадастровому номеру |
Компании (8)
Инструмент | Стоимость | Описание |
| Бесплатно | Поиск по названию, ИНН или ОГРН |
| Бесплатно | Информация о компании по ИНН. Базовые данные бесплатно; финансы и все коды ОКВЭД — только тариф «Максимальный» |
| Максимальный | Аффилированные компании по ИНН. Не работает на бесплатном тарифе |
| 7 ₽ | Компания по корпоративному email или домену |
| 7 ₽ | Бренд, сайт и логотип по ИНН |
| Бесплатно | Проверка самозанятого по ИНН (через ФНС) |
| Бесплатно | Компании Беларуси по названию или УНП |
| Бесплатно | Компании Казахстана по названию или БИН |
Банки (1)
Инструмент | Стоимость | Описание |
| Бесплатно | Поиск по БИК, SWIFT, ИНН, рег. номеру или названию |
ФИО (2)
Инструмент | Стоимость | Описание |
| Бесплатно | Автодополнение ФИО с определением пола |
| 0.20 ₽ | Разбор ФИО, определение пола, склонение по падежам |
Контакты (3)
Инструмент | Стоимость | Описание |
| 0.20 ₽ | Проверка телефона: оператор, регион, часовой пояс |
| 0.20 ₽ | Проверка email: исправление опечаток, одноразовый/корпоративный/личный |
| Бесплатно | Автодополнение email с подсказкой доменов |
Паспорта (3)
Инструмент | Стоимость | Описание |
| 0.20 ₽ | Проверка по реестру недействительных паспортов МВД |
| Бесплатно | Кем выдан паспорт по коду подразделения |
| Бесплатно | ИНН по паспортным данным и дате рождения (через ФНС) |
Автомобили (2)
Инструмент | Стоимость | Описание |
| 0.20 ₽ | Распознавание марки и модели из строки |
| Бесплатно | Автодополнение марок автомобилей |
Геолокация (2)
Инструмент | Стоимость | Описание |
| Бесплатно | Обратное геокодирование: адрес по координатам |
| Бесплатно | Город по IP-адресу |
Почта и страны (2)
Инструмент | Стоимость | Описание |
| Бесплатно | Почтовое отделение по индексу или координатам |
| Бесплатно | Справочник стран (ISO 3166) |
Логистика (1)
Инструмент | Стоимость | Описание |
| Бесплатно | ID города в СДЭК, Boxberry, DPD по коду КЛАДР |
Композитная проверка (1)
Инструмент | Стоимость | Описание |
| 0.20 ₽ | Проверка записи о человеке одним запросом: ФИО + адрес + телефон + email + паспорт. В 5-8 раз дешевле раздельных запросов |
Справочники (1 инструмент, 12 справочников)
Инструмент | Стоимость | Описание |
| Бесплатно | ОКВЭД 2, ОКПД 2, ОКТМО, станции метро, налоговые (ФНС), таможни (ФТС), суды, валюты (ISO 4217), МКТУ, профессии, должности, медицинские должности |
Личный кабинет (2)
Инструмент | Стоимость | Описание |
| Бесплатно | Баланс и статистика использования за день |
| Бесплатно | Даты обновления справочников |
Ресурсы
dadata://reference/quality-codes— Расшифровка кодов качества DaData (qc, qc_geo) и уровней достоверностиdadata://reference/capabilities— Возможности API: бесплатные/платные функции, лимиты
Промпты
check_counterparty— Проверка контрагента по ИНН: статус, руководитель, финансы, оценка рискаvalidate_address— Пошаговая валидация адреса с оценкой качества
Переменные окружения
Переменная | Обязательна | Описание |
| Да | API-ключ — зарегистрируйтесь бесплатно и получите в личном кабинете |
| Нет | Секретный ключ для платных инструментов ( |
Тарифы и лимиты
Подробнее: dadata.ru/pricing
Бесплатный тариф: до 10 000 запросов в сутки. Достаточно для разработки и небольших проектов.
Тариф «Максимальный» необходим для:
find_affiliated— поиск аффилированных компаний (не работает на бесплатном тарифе)find_company_by_id— полные данные (финансы, все коды ОКВЭД приходят только на «Максимальном»; базовая информация доступна бесплатно)
Платные инструменты (
clean_*) — от 0.20 ₽ за запрос, требуютDADATA_SECRET_KEY
Примеры запросов
Найди компанию по ИНН 7707083893Стандартизируй адрес: мск сухонская 11 кв 89Проверь контрагента с ИНН 7736207543 — компания действует?Какой город у IP 46.226.227.20?Найди БИК и корсчёт СбербанкаПроверь паспорт 4510 235857 — есть в реестре недействительных?Найди ОКВЭД для «разработка программного обеспечения»Безопасность
API-ключи никогда не логируются и не попадают в ответы об ошибках
Все входные данные валидируются через Zod-схемы
Защита от path traversal при построении эндпоинтов
Жёсткий таймаут 10 секунд на все HTTP-запросы
Повторные попытки с экспоненциальным backoff только на временные ошибки (429, 5xx)
stdoutзарезервирован для JSON-RPC — логи идут вstderr
Разработка
git clone https://github.com/theYahia/dadata-mcp.git
cd dadata-mcp
npm install
npm run build
npm testТест через MCP Inspector
DADATA_API_KEY=your-key npx @modelcontextprotocol/inspector node dist/index.jsОткроется интерактивный UI на http://localhost:6274 для вызова инструментов и просмотра JSON-RPC сообщений.
Часть серии Russian API MCP
Этот сервер — часть открытой серии MCP-серверов для российских API:
MCP | Статус | Описание |
✅ готов | Адреса, компании, банки, телефоны | |
@theyahia/cbr-mcp | 📅 скоро | Курсы валют, ключевая ставка |
@theyahia/yookassa-mcp | 📅 скоро | Платежи, возвраты, чеки 54-ФЗ |
@theyahia/moysklad-mcp | 📅 скоро | Склад, заказы, контрагенты |
@theyahia/cdek-mcp | 📅 скоро | Расчёт, создание, трекинг |
@theyahia/ozon-mcp | 📅 скоро | Товары, цены, аналитика |
@theyahia/amocrm-mcp | 📅 скоро | Сделки, контакты, воронки |
... | 📅 | +43 сервера — полный список на витрине |
50 MCP-серверов для российских API: github.com/theYahia/russian-mcp
Лицензия
MIT
This server cannot be installed
Maintenance
Latest Blog Posts
MCP directory API
We provide all the information about MCP servers via our MCP API.
curl -X GET 'https://glama.ai/api/mcp/v1/servers/theYahia/dadata-mcp'
If you have feedback or need assistance with the MCP directory API, please join our Discord server